How many days does it take to remove stitches after laparoscopic surgery for ectopic pregnancy?

For the surgical treatment of ectopic pregnancy, laparoscopic surgery is now mostly used. Because laparoscopic surgery is a minimally invasive surgery, it has the characteristics of small trauma and fast recovery. It always leaves three to four postoperative scars less than one centimeter on the patient's abdomen. It is very beautiful and generous, and is deeply favored by many ladies who pursue beauty. We usually remove the sutures five days after the operation. When removing the sutures, we will observe the detailed condition of the wound to see if there is any swelling, extravasation, or wound dehiscence. If these conditions do not occur and the wound is healing well, the sutures are usually removed five days later. Of course, because cosmetic threads are used nowadays, many wounds do not require surgical suture removal.

What are the common problems after laparoscopy for ectopic pregnancy? Infertility experts explain in detail that ectopic pregnancy refers to the embryo implantation and development of the fertilized egg outside the uterus, also known as ectopic pregnancy. With the continuous development of daily life, the incidence of ectopic pregnancy has gradually increased in recent years. Laparoscopic treatment is used for ectopic pregnancy.

Regarding the common problems after laparoscopy for ectopic pregnancy, experts said that within 2 weeks after laparoscopy for ectopic pregnancy, you should rest moderately, avoid doing heavy physical work, eat more nutritious food to make the body recover as soon as possible, and prohibit sexual intercourse within 1 month to prevent reproductive infection. If you want to get pregnant, you have to wait one year. If you have a fever, abdominal pain, or an unusual odor in your female discharge, seek medical attention immediately.

Detailed key points of common problems after laparoscopy for ectopic pregnancy:

1. Maintain a regular daily routine: Even if the surgery is successful, if the daily routine after the surgery is not regular, it may aggravate bleeding or cause complications.

2. Clothing should be relatively loose and not too tight.

3. During this period, do not drink alcohol or take a bath without the doctor's approval, because bathing may sometimes cause infection.

4. In order to ensure the health of the pregnant mother, do not get pregnant immediately after the operation. Because the uterus is damaged during the operation, pregnancy at this time is very dangerous, so safe contraceptive methods must be adopted.
